When dealing with  strong electricity, like the kind for sending power long distances,  making sure  its safe and work good is super important. This is where hipot testing comes in. Think of it like a strong but careful check for those big electric cables. We send special voltage, a bit more  than normal, through it for a short time. It's not  to break anything; it finds weak spots or issues in the cable's insulation, that protective layer that stops electricity from escaping. If the cable can handle this extra push without a problem, it means it's strong and safe. If it can't, there is a problem that needs  fixing before use. This test is like a safety net, catching dangers before they cause trouble  like shorts, fires, or outages. It's  a key step so electricity gets to us  safely.

What is hipot testing for high voltage cables?

Hipot testing applies high voltage to cables to verify insulation integrity and detect leaks or defects before service.
